It looks like electrical registration is not a pre-requisite. Guessing, but most likely it covers correct use of the test instruments and results, and consequences of different kinds of appliance faults. Most of these things are effectively internally assessed and the competency assessment at the end will be kind of guided + repeats for any bits you get wrong.
